Madonna gave quite a show last night (December 2), dancing with Ariana Grande for charity’s sake.

Ariana stepped out in Madonna’s own Rebel Heart Tour flapper dress, to join the Queen of Pop on stage at her Raising Malawi Benefit at Art Basel Miami Beach. And to keep the celebrity guests (Leonardo DiCaprioChris RockDave Chappelle, Paris Hilton) entertained, Madonna and Ariana shimmied and shook what their mama gave them to Madonna’s 2000 #1 hit “Music.”

Thank you for having me be a part of such an important evening and for giving giving giving as much as you do,” Ariana said on Instagram.

Then there was the cameras didn’t capture. Associated Press reports that Madonna kissed Ariana, spoke out on behalf of Standing Rock protesters by singing “American Life,” and covered Britney Spears‘ “Toxic” as images of president-elect Donald Trump appeared on the screen. Madonna would raise more than $7.5 million for Malawi, where she also adopted Chifundo “Mercy” James, then four years old.
